• The Java programming language and Java software platform have been criticized for design choices including the implementation of generics, forced object-oriented...
    32 KB (3,615 words) - 12:28, 8 May 2025
  • Thumbnail for JavaScript
    JavaScript (JS) is a programming language and core technology of the World Wide Web, alongside HTML and CSS. Ninety-nine percent of websites use JavaScript...
    84 KB (7,915 words) - 11:58, 9 August 2025
  • (WORA), meaning that comp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led...
    73 KB (6,633 words) - 09:42, 29 July 2025
  • Thumbnail for Criticism
    Criticism is the construction of a judgement about the negative or positive qualities of someone or something. Criticism can range from impromptu comments...
    9 KB (1,015 words) - 22:46, 24 May 2025
  • became an industry standard practice. Criticism of Java – Criticism of the Java programming language and Java software platform Cross-platform software § Challenges...
    3 KB (298 words) - 12:52, 16 July 2025
  • operating system, and a suite of security APIs that Java developers can utilise. Despite this, criticism has been directed at the programming language, and...
    19 KB (2,034 words) - 04:36, 30 June 2025
  • Thumbnail for Java (software platform)
    Java is a set of computer software and specifications that provides a software platform for developing application software and deploying it in a cross-platform...
    77 KB (8,479 words) - 00:13, 6 August 2025
  • Thumbnail for Film criticism
    Film criticism is the analysis and evaluation of films and the film medium. In general, film criticism can be divided into two categories: Academic criticism...
    48 KB (6,175 words) - 08:27, 17 July 2025
  • genre of arts criticism, literary criticism or literary studies is the study, evaluation, and interpretation of literature. Modern literary criticism is...
    32 KB (3,661 words) - 14:27, 26 July 2025
  • Java. While the focus of this article is mainly the languages and their features, such a comparison will necessarily also consider some features of platforms...
    152 KB (13,904 words) - 09:47, 29 July 2025
  • Thumbnail for Scala (programming language)
    many of Scala's design decisions are intended to address criticisms of Java. Scala source code can be compiled to Java bytecode and run on a Java virtual...
    109 KB (10,214 words) - 09:52, 29 July 2025
  • Thumbnail for East Java
    in the easternmost third of Java island. It has a land border only with the province of Central Java to the west; the Java Sea and the Indian Ocean border...
    99 KB (8,649 words) - 01:06, 10 August 2025
  • Thumbnail for Art criticism
    Art criticism is the discussion or evaluation of visual art. Art critics usually criticize art in the context of aesthetics or the theory of beauty. A...
    44 KB (4,809 words) - 05:28, 18 March 2025
  • high-performance software development for much of the 21st century, and are often directly compared and contrasted. Java's syntax was based on C/C++. The differences...
    68 KB (6,126 words) - 19:36, 30 July 2025
  • etc. One of the most often criticized points of C++ is its perceived complexity as a language, with the criticism that a large number of non-orthogonal...
    21 KB (2,688 words) - 11:39, 25 June 2025
  • Thumbnail for Java syntax
    syntax of Java is the set of rules defining how a Java program is written and interpreted. The syntax is mostly derived from C and C++. Unlike C++, Java has...
    73 KB (7,938 words) - 20:01, 13 July 2025
  • Self-criticism involves how an individual evaluates oneself. Self-criticism in psychology is typically studied and discussed as a negative personality...
    21 KB (2,777 words) - 14:07, 5 March 2025
  • Javadoc (redirect from Java doc)
    capitalized as JavaDoc or javadoc) is an API documentation generator for the Java programming language. Based on information in Java source code, Javadoc...
    11 KB (874 words) - 10:17, 10 May 2025
  • Thumbnail for Ahmad Luthfi
    governor of Central Java since February 2025. He was previously a three-star police general, with his last office being the chief of Central Java police...
    13 KB (1,136 words) - 08:32, 31 July 2025
  • Social criticism is a form of academic or journalistic criticism focusing on social issues in contemporary society, in respect to perceived injustices...
    12 KB (1,490 words) - 22:42, 31 July 2025
  • will commonly use the methods of literary criticism. Such a review often contains evaluations of the book on the basis of personal taste. Reviewers, in...
    11 KB (1,635 words) - 10:40, 6 August 2025
  • Thumbnail for Brendan Eich
    Brendan Eich (category People associated with JavaScript)
    user base, commenting that this echoed the criticism that led to his resignation from Mozilla. Brendan Eich: JavaScript, Firefox, Mozilla, and Brave | Lex...
    29 KB (2,413 words) - 17:35, 3 August 2025
  • of criticism and legal action. This includes its handling labor violations at its outsourced manufacturing hubs in China, its environmental impact of...
    84 KB (7,844 words) - 18:01, 27 July 2025
  • The War on Terror is the campaign launched by the United States of America in response to the September 11 attacks against organizations designated with...
    179 KB (3,465 words) - 21:27, 7 July 2025
  • standard technical specifications for Java technology. Becoming a member of the JCP requires solid knowledge of the Java programming language, its specifications...
    28 KB (669 words) - 14:54, 25 March 2025
  • Critique (category Criticism)
    Gianni Vattimo, criticism is used more frequently to denote literary criticism or art criticism, that is, the interpretation and evaluation of literature and...
    8 KB (990 words) - 03:37, 17 July 2025
  • Thumbnail for Dedi Mulyadi
    Dedi Mulyadi (category Governors of West Java)
    Gerindra party who is the 15th governor of West Java, serving since February 2025. He was previously the regent of Purwakarta, holding that position between...
    20 KB (1,520 words) - 19:54, 8 August 2025
  • Thumbnail for Criticism of science
    Criticism of science addresses problems within science in order to improve science as a whole and its role in society. Criticisms come from philosophy...
    31 KB (3,620 words) - 13:50, 26 May 2025
  • Jakarta Server Pages (JSP; formerly JavaServer Pages) is a collection of technologies that helps software developers create dynamically generated web pages...
    18 KB (1,930 words) - 05:59, 26 February 2025
  • Embrace, extend, and extinguish (category Microsoft criticisms and controversies)
    legal implications of their breach of contract. Sun sued Microsoft over Java again in 2002 and Microsoft agreed to settle out of court for US$2 billion...
    19 KB (2,153 words) - 02:54, 2 August 2025